On the morning of November 25, Politburo member, Party Central Committee Secretary, and President of the Vietnam Fatherland Front Central Committee Bui Thi Minh Hoai received the delegation attending the 13th Vietnam-China People's Forum.
At the meeting, Mr. Phan Anh Son, Chairman of the Vietnam Union of Friendship Organizations, briefly informed about the 13th Vietnam-China People's Forum held on November 24 in Hanoi .
With the theme "75 years of Vietnam-China friendship - Building a solid people's foundation," this year's Forum revolves around four groups of content including 75 years of Vietnam-China friendship; national governance models and perspectives; economic -trade-investment cooperation and education-science-technology cooperation; thereby enhancing political understanding and trust, consolidating a solid social foundation, highly appreciated by the leaders of the two countries, becoming an important foreign relations foundation between the people of the two countries.

In recent years, the leaders of the two Parties and States have maintained regular contact and visited each other. During their State visits, General Secretary and President Xi Jinping and General Secretary To Lam both took time to meet with friendly personalities and youth representatives of the two countries.
This China-Vietnam People's Forum is an important mechanism project stated in the China-Vietnam Joint Statement, receiving special attention from the leaders of the two Parties and the two States. Since its inception in 2010, the Forum has been held 13 times.
